Biography of Starbucks (Brand Overview)
Starbucks, founded in 1971 in Seattle, Washington, has grown into a global coffeehouse giant. Known for its signature beverages, Starbucks also offers a variety of food items ranging from pastries to sandwiches. Understanding the brand’s commitment to quality and sustainability can help you appreciate the nutritional aspects of its offerings.
Starbucks Nutrition Guide Food is not just about numbers; it’s about aligning with the company’s mission to provide high-quality products. Below is a brief overview of the brand’s journey:
| Category | Details |
|---|---|
| Founding Year | 1971 |
| Headquarters | Seattle, Washington |
| Global Presence | Over 30,000 stores worldwide |
| Core Offerings | Coffee, tea, espresso drinks, pastries, sandwiches, and more |

Calorie Breakdown of Popular Starbucks Food Items
Calories are one of the most important factors to consider when choosing food at Starbucks. Here’s a breakdown of the calorie content in some popular items:
- Blueberry Muffin: Approximately 410 calories
- Cinnamon Roll: Approximately 370 calories
- Spinach and Feta Breakfast Wrap: Approximately 360 calories
- Protein Bistro Box: Approximately 270 calories
These numbers can vary based on size and customization, so it’s always a good idea to check the official Starbucks Nutrition Guide Food for precise information.
Sugar Content in Starbucks Food
Sugar is another critical factor to consider, especially for those watching their sugar intake. Here’s a look at the sugar content in some popular Starbucks food items:
- Chocolate Chunk Cookie: Approximately 15g of sugar
- Apple Fritter: Approximately 27g of sugar
- Protein Bistro Box: Approximately 5g of sugar
Reducing sugar intake can be challenging, but Starbucks offers several options with lower sugar content to help you stay on track.
Fat Content in Starbucks Food
Fat content is also an important consideration for maintaining a healthy diet. Here’s a breakdown of the fat content in some popular Starbucks food items:
- Cheese Danish: Approximately 10g of fat
- Spinach and Feta Breakfast Wrap: Approximately 13g of fat
- Protein Bistro Box: Approximately 10g of fat
Starbucks strives to offer items with balanced fat content, ensuring that customers can enjoy their food without excessive fat intake.
